Controller Job Description SampleController Job Description SampleController Job Description SampleThiscontroller sample job description can assist in your creating a job application that will attract job candidates who are qualified for the job. Feel free to revise this job description to meet your specific job duties and job requirements.Controller Job ResponsibilitiesMaximizes return on financial assets by establishing financial policies, procedures, controls, and reporting systems.Controller Job DutiesGuides financial decisions by establishing, monitoring, and enforcing policies and procedures.Protects assets by establishing, monitoring, and enforcing internal controls.Monitors and confirms financial condition by conducting audits providing information to external auditors.Maximizes return, and limits risk, on cash by minimizing bank balances making investments.Prepares budgets by establishing schedules collecting, analyzing, and consolidating financial data recommending plans.Ac hieves budget objectives by scheduling expenditures analyzing variances initiating corrective actions.Provides status of financial condition by collecting, interpreting, and reporting financial data.Prepares special reports by collecting, analyzing, and summarizing information and trends.Complies with federal, state, and local legal requirements by studying existing and new legislation anticipating future legislation enforcing adherence to requirements filing financial reports advising management on needed actions.Ensures operation of equipment by establishing preventive maintenance requirements and service contracts maintaining equipment inventories evaluating new equipment and techniques.Completes operational requirements by scheduling and assigning employees following up on work results.Maintains financial staff by recruiting, selecting, orienting, and training employees.Maintains financial staff job results by coaching, counseling, and disciplining employees planning, monitoring , and appraising job results.Maintains professional and technical knowledge by attending educational workshops reviewing professional publications establishing personal networks participating in professional societies.Protects operations by keeping financial information and plans confidential.Contributes to kollektiv effort by accomplishing related results as needed.Controller Skills and QualificationsManaging Processes, Financial Software, Developing Standards, Audit, Accounting, Corporate Finance, Tracking Budget Expenses, Financial Skills, Analyzing Information , Developing Budgets, Performance ManagementEmployers Post a job in minutes to reach candidates everywhere.
